Step 1: create a new folder (skin) and add a layer (base) to it. make sure to keep the skin folder at the very bottom, because we want to color under the lines and not over them. quick tip: if you give your folders and layers names, it will be easier and faster for you to find your layers. 1.high. with this drawing i decided to let the light come from the top left. i always like to start with the shading on the face, first i use a darker shade than our skin and for the deeper shadows i use a dark purple gray shade. in doing so, i shade the areas under the hair and eyes parallel to the light.
